Repadded my seats

I have always thought the seats in this car were crap. I know the car is 10 years old and the seats have taken some sitting in, but my 300 is 24 years old and has almost twice the miles and the seats in it are super comfortable and can be comfortable for many hours of driving. The Z4 gets rough after about an hour to me.

So I yanked them and had a guy open them up and reinforce them and add another layer of denser padding. So far I think it helped a lot.




I also took the time to scrub the seats all up and protect them while I had them out. If you think your seats are spotless - take them out and get them in the sunlight!

I also took the time to clean all the carpeting up under the seats - which were surprising very clean. I did have a few spots from the seat grease , so I got some of this to try on them.

http://www.amazon.com/BlueMagic-900-...carpet+cleaner

All I can say is WOW - this stuff works great! Just spray it on and wait a few seconds and hit with a clean dry cloth and it came out like magic. Very impressed with this and plan to go through my SUV with it this weekend.

So far I think the new padding will help a ton. He also added some layers of vinyl in there between the springs and stuff to help keep them from "feeling" through. Cost was $180 - seems to be well worth it so far.

FYI if anyone else is wondering about giving it a try.
